About the cover image: The Andromeda Galaxy (M31) is one of our closest galactic neighbors, just 2.5 million light-years away. We are on a collision course, but it won’t happen for a few billion years. Brian took this shot through his 10” f/5 reflector, on a Michigan-made PlaneWave L-350, with a Canon 5DmkIII. About ten hours’ worth of individual images were added together to make this shot.
